The Safeguarding and Care Planning Service works in partnership with other agencies such as Police, Health and Education, and aims to ensure children grow up with the best life chances and receive safe and consistent care.

The Court Team is a specialist team within the Safeguarding Service. The focus of the work is with children at significant risk of harm where intervention of the court is necessary to protect them. Many of these children become looked after by the Local Authority in the interim and subsequently may not be able to return to their parents. They may be permanently cared for elsewhere by living with either extended family, long term foster care or adoption under a Court Order.

The Court Team consists of a Team Manager and 6 Senior Practitioners.

This team works in partnership with the Bromley Children's Legal Team to ensure that children's cases that are presented to court are well prepared and timely.

The position requires recent court experience and the ideal candidate would be keen to join a team that specialises in court work within a safeguarding team.

The prospective candidate needs to:

  • Be very well organised, have the ability to communicate effectively and articulate evidence in care proceedings.
  • Write reports to a high standard, that are concise, evidence based for court and adoption panel (i.e Child Permanency and Adoption Placement Reports)
  • Meet court timelines for submission of statements, care plans, and to effectively parallel plan for children considering all relevant options to secure permanent care at the earliest opportunity for the child.
  • Undertake assessments (i.e parenting and together and apart assessments), plan appropriate intervention and work creatively with children and families who are in court proceedings
  • Have a good understanding of safeguarding thresholds and ability to assess and analysis risks, including good knowledge of child development and attachment theories and permanency needs of children of all ages.
